Output fba521e239705f84d4c9d3a45d122f1bc372c3b70db1895ecbf5ab01e8125ada:1

value
709995653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 366a11e9b21d841d7793d9a7fc722344a1bbff72 OP_EQUALVERIFY OP_CHECKSIG
address
15xiZEKkQN7YqPrFFnKHR32dj6wyJbcdQg
transaction
fba521e239705f84d4c9d3a45d122f1bc372c3b70db1895ecbf5ab01e8125ada
spent
true